Centres 'threaten nursery education'

By Nicole Weinstein, Nursery World, 16 March 2006

Slow stealth privatisation of the state nursery sector is 'letting down' the country's most vulnerable children and families, concerned head teachers warned at a crisis meeting.

More than 80 nursery school heads and professionals met at the House of Commons to discuss, 'Are we waving goodbye to state nursery education?', a debate organised by the National Campaign for Real Nursery Education (NCRNE).
